Transaction 21cf87040deba30342e4a48fb041a577c647f57fbef389aaebcebeda79f47c9d
1 Input
2 Outputs
- 21cf87040deba30342e4a48fb041a577c647f57fbef389aaebcebeda79f47c9d:0
- 21cf87040deba30342e4a48fb041a577c647f57fbef389aaebcebeda79f47c9d:1
value 308721
address 34BRhdoPLD6o3wCSs1ti63AbRWUgUv9i4K
value 133056
address bc1qs59hr473w5hg7gecjz0ykw3su880p7cu3289ue